My dog, Teddy, got a scratch on his cornea and received wonderful care here. Before discovering this, the affected eye had swelling, redness, and pupil constriction. Trying to avoid a costly visit to an animal hospital, I called a few vets prior to discovering Boston Veterinary Clinic. They were the only ones that found a way to fit Teddy into their schedule same day - I called at 12:32pm and had an appointment at 1pm! We were cared by Vet Randi Henry & an assistant (I forget her name, but she was awesome). They put a numbing agent and temporary stain in his eye to identify the scratch, flushed it clean, gave us eye drops and pain meds and we were on our way. We have since received calls asking how Teddy is doing. We would be fine without, but it is definitely reassuring to know our vet is accessible. The folks at the front desk are on the quiet side. Our vet said she’d like to see us in a follow up appointment, but no one at the desk mentioned it when we checked out. All good otherwise. Thank you!

Dr Bourquin has been our Golden Retriever Sam’s vet since we first picked him up from the breeder at 8 weeks. Sam had a number of medical issues early on – Dr Bourquin’s expertise as well as his kind and compassionate demeanor always kept us calm and comfortable knowing we were in very capable hands. Our most recent interaction was when Sam had a Mast Cell Tumor - a very scary diagnosis. Dr Bourquin taught us from the start how to recognize important 'bumps' as they can be dangerous - as this one turned out to be. He helped us navigate the needed surgery and was available to answer our concerns as we made our way through the recovery process. We have no doubt that Dr Bourquin saved Sam's life with his preventative care and education. He is a skilled diagnostician – we completely trust him with our Sam
